When it comes to equipping your kitchen with versatile and efficient tools, hand blenders stand out as indispensable appliances. Two renowned brands, Cuisinart and KitchenAid, offer exceptional hand blenders that cater to various culinary needs. This comprehensive guide will delve into the nuances of Cuisinart vs KitchenAid hand blenders, helping you make an informed decision based on your specific requirements.

Power and Performance

Both Cuisinart and KitchenAid hand blenders boast impressive motors that deliver optimal performance. Cuisinart’s models offer a range of power options, with some models featuring up to 500 watts of power for effortless blending. KitchenAid hand blenders, on the other hand, generally have higher wattage ratings, with some models reaching 800 watts for exceptional power and efficiency.

Design and Ergonomics

Design and ergonomics play a crucial role in the user experience of hand blenders. Cuisinart hand blenders are known for their sleek and modern designs, often featuring non-slip handles and lightweight construction for comfortable use. KitchenAid hand blenders, on the other hand, are renowned for their sturdy and durable construction, with some models featuring metal bodies for enhanced durability.

Attachments and Versatility

Versatility is a key consideration when choosing a hand blender. Cuisinart hand blenders come with a variety of attachments, including whisks, mashers, and chopping bowls, making them suitable for a wide range of tasks. KitchenAid hand blenders also offer a range of attachments, although they may not be as comprehensive as Cuisinart’s offerings.

Speed and Control

Speed and control are essential for precise blending. Cuisinart hand blenders typically offer variable speed settings, allowing users to adjust the blending speed based on the task at hand. KitchenAid hand blenders also feature variable speed settings, but some models may have more precise speed control than Cuisinart’s models.

Cleaning and Maintenance

Cleaning and maintenance are important factors to consider when choosing a hand blender. Both Cuisinart and KitchenAid hand blenders have detachable attachments for easy cleaning. However, some Cuisinart models feature dishwasher-safe attachments, while KitchenAid models generally require hand washing.

Price and Value

Price and value are significant factors for many consumers. Cuisinart hand blenders offer a range of models at various price points, with some models being more affordable than KitchenAid’s offerings. KitchenAid hand blenders, on the other hand, tend to be more expensive, but they often come with additional features and attachments.

The Verdict: Which Hand Blender is Right for You?

The choice between Cuisinart and KitchenAid hand blenders ultimately depends on your individual needs and preferences. If you seek a versatile and affordable hand blender with a wide range of attachments, Cuisinart is an excellent choice. If you prioritize power, durability, and precise speed control, KitchenAid hand blenders may be a better fit.
